Title
Reaction of a P/Al-Based Frustrated Lewis Pair with Ammonia, Borane, and Amine-Boranes: Adduct Formation and Catalytic Dehydrogenation
Author(s)
Appelt, C; Slootweg, JC; Lammertsma, K; Uhl, W

Abstract
Open wide! The geminal P/Al-based frustrated Lewis pair (Mes2 P)(tBu2 Al)CC(H)Ph forms stable Lewis adducts with BH3 and NH3 . This compound facilitates the dehydrocoupling of the ammonia-borane adduct by unusual NH bond activation and elimination of dihydrogen at the boron center, and it is a very active main-group-based FLP catalyst for the dehydrogenation of amine-borane H3 B⋅NMe2 H.
Keywords
amineboranes; dehydrogenation; density functional calculations; frustrated Lewis pairs; homogeneous catalysis
